Hindustan Copper Limited opened its qualified institutional placement (QIP) issue of Equity Shares of face value 5/- each for subscription on April 7. The floor price has been fixed at Rs125.79 per equity share.

The company may offer a discount of not more than 5% on the Floor Price so calculated for the Issue. The issue price will be determined by the company in consultation with the Book Running Lead Managers appointed for the Issue.

At around 11.20 am, Hindustan Copper Limited was trading at Rs146.80 per piece up Rs1.65 or 1.14% on the BSE.
